Title :
Using Experimental FORC Distribution as Input for a Preisach-Type Model
Author :
Stoleriu, Laurentiu ; Stancu, Alexandru
Author_Institution :
Fac. of Phys., Al.I. Cuza Univ.
Abstract :
In this paper, we present a method of using the experimental first-order reversal curves (FORC) distribution as input for Preisach-type models. In order to be able to calculate in the model the integral over the FORC distribution we designed an interpolation algorithm of the three-dimensional (3-D) distribution. The algorithm is validated for a simple case-the output of a classical Preisach model-and then is used for realistic, asymmetrical FORC distributions. Several Preisach-type models are tested for the same FORC distribution and it is shown that the PM2 model gives the best results in simulating magnetization curves starting from the FORC diagram
